Job Description:
If you are a dynamic, adaptable, and experienced project manager passionate about delivering successful projects, we encourage you to apply. As a senior project manager at Parsons, you will play a pivotal role in ensuring that assigned projects meet client and corporate objectives.
You will serve as the primary point of contact with clients throughout project execution. Your responsibilities will include managing scope, schedule, and budget, being proactive, and recommending process improvements.
As a client service manager, you will be responsible for prospecting new business and maintaining strong relationships with existing clients and partners. You will lead efforts to win new work and generate business in the Greater Toronto Region.
The successful candidate will have extensive project management experience, adaptability to changing priorities, exceptional organizational skills, and a dedication to achieving project success.
